blueish tint of the fake hid/xenon blub have little to do with kelvin, there's a coat of blue color tint(or any color for that matter), once the yellowish/stock looking light pass thru the transparent blue tint,the output light will be much blue/white-er.
notice there's a loss of visible light in the transition, that's why those blub usually are higher in wattage.
there's a chrome looking blub by piaa that will blink pure white for the blinkers
